+/**
+ * Intended for {@link org.apache.solr.core.CoreContainer} plugins that should be
+ * enabled only one instance per cluster.
+ * <p>Implementation detail: currently these plugins are instantiated on the
+ * Overseer leader, and closed when the current node loses its leadership.</p>
+ */
+@Retention(RetentionPolicy.RUNTIME)
+public @interface ClusterSingleton {

Review comment:
       I'm not sure Solr core code should be responsible for coordinating plugins' coordination like this. I feel we should keep this coordination left to the plugins. I am NOT saying that the autoscaling plugin should do this on its own, but I am just saying that "some plugin" should do it for the autoscaling plugin. IOW, this coordination code shouldn't be in solr-core.
   As an example, we can have two plugins:
   "autoscaling-framework-plugin" depends on "lifecycle-coordination-plugin". The latter can have these concepts defined in them, including the actual implementation.
